We were staying at a nearby hotel (AC) within walking distance and I needed a hearty breakfast before an all day tattoo session. RedEye is decorated like you're in a 50's diner. With a Jukebox, glossy red everything, metal coating, and photos of celebrities, it's a lot of fun! Our waitress was a gem. She was friendly, attentive, and quick. We ordered the RedEye Special with a waffle, waffle with blueberry compote, and biscuits with gravy. Everything was delicious except for the grits that I ordered on the side...it tasted like it was made with mildew water. I ate it and was fine but it didn't taste great at all. The biscuits and gravy were phenomenal!! I would definitely order those again. Overall, great place to go for early morning breakfast, especially if you're staying at the AC hotel where it's just an elevator ride down and few steps away. I just don't recommend the grits. But do order the biscuits and gravy (with an extra side of gravy because omg).
